Philippe and Mathilda will see the pope in December

King Philippe and his wife Queen Mathilda will see the pope on the 12th of December. They will visit pope François at the Vatican for the first time, a Vatican spokesman has said. The Palace's spokesman confirmed it, without giving any more details. The last time the Belgian monarchy visited the Vatican was October 2009. Albert II and Paola visited Benoît XVI.
Although he is a practicing catholic, King Albert II signed a law decriminalizing euthanasia during his reign. He also signed a law authorizing gay marriage.

Philippe, a catholic from the Community of Emmanuel, seems to have the same attitude as his father. They are both respectful of the Belgian constitution and its limits. He signed a controversial law in 2014 extending euthanasia to children.
